Subject: First-aid room relocation — Brindle Wharf site

Team,

The first-aid room has moved from Ground Floor East to Room 1.04, next to the print hub. Old room is now storage — redirect anyone heading there. Stock check is Fridays; flag low supplies to the duty manager. Defibrillator stays in its current wall cabinet by reception. Room 1.04 is kept locked outside staffed hours for medication security. Reception staff may open it in an emergency using the door code provided below.

turnstile pass: bdg-JBCWS-7

## Deploying the Gatewick Proctor Queue

Deploys are pretty painless: push to main, wait for the pipeline, then watch the queue drain dashboard for five minutes. If candidates pile up mid-exam, roll back first and ask questions later — the queue replays safely. Everything the workers care about lives in one config block, shown here for reference.

settings of bafof-yagef:
JOROX_PIN=8740
JOROX_TENANT=pelox
JOROX_METRICS_HOST=metrics.jorox.qorvelworks.internal
JOROX_SEAL=seal_c78f63c1
JOROX_STANDBY_TEAM=norax

Runbook: Profile Store Sharding (Atlasgrain)

When migrating user-profile shards, always drain writes to the source shard first via the Atlasgrain control plane, then run the copy job, then flip the routing table. Verify row counts before unfreezing writes. The control plane rejects unauthenticated shard operations. Authenticate your session with the key that follows.

app token of bahaf-tajeg = zpat23_SjjsllwiLmXbtS65veZaV47